These days, finding an affordable place to live in the Ellenboro area can be challenging. Home prices in Ellenboro are now at a median cost of $122,918, lower than the North Carolina average of $226,477.
The average cost of rent is $746/mo in Ellenboro, primarily driven by the current value of real estate in the Ellenboro area. While nearly 59.96% of residents own their homes outright in Ellenboro, 15.56% rent.
Housing affordability isn’t just about home prices, though. The average household income in Ellenboro is $4,441 per month. Households that rent pay about 16.79% of their income on rent here. Ellenboro's most expensive areas are in the northeastern regions, while the cheapest areas are in the southeastern parts of the city.
